We are seeking an experienced and compassionate Speech, Language and Communication Needs (SLCN) Teaching Assistant to join a welcoming primary school in Shepherd's Bush. This is a full-time, long-term role supporting a non-verbal child with autism, starting as soon as possible.

The Role

Provide tailored one-to-one support for a non-verbal child with autism.

Use specialist strategies to promote communication, interaction, and engagement.

Implement Speech and Language Therapy programmes in collaboration with external specialists.

Support the child's learning, social development, and emotional well-being within the classroom and during wider school activities.

Work closely with the class teacher, SENCO, and parents to ensure consistent, targeted support.

About You

Proven experience supporting children with autism and SLCN, ideally with non-verbal pupils.

Knowledge of communication approaches such as PECS, Makaton, AAC, or visual supports (desirable).

Patient, empathetic, and resilient, with a nurturing approach.

Strong communication and interpersonal skills to work effectively with staff, families, and professionals.

A genuine passion for helping children thrive and achieve their potential.
